Azalea Pruning Questions
Why should azaleas be pruned? Pruning helps maintain the plant’s shape, encourages healthy growth, and promotes vibrant blooms each season.
When is the best time to prune azaleas? The ideal time to prune azaleas is shortly after they finish flowering, typically in late spring or early summer.
What tools are needed for azalea pruning? Sharp pruning shears or scissors are recommended to make clean cuts and prevent damage to the plant.
How much of the azalea should be pruned? Generally, about one-third of the plant can be removed to shape it without harming its health or flowering ability.
